    Getting There

    Car

    If you're traveling by car in Northern Region, head to the M5 road, which runs along the western edge of Lake Malawi. From the town of Mzuzu, drive south on the M5 for approximately 70 km. As you approach Chintheche, look for signs indicating Chintheche INN. The inn is located near the lakeshore, and you can easily spot it as you approach the area. There is ample parking available at the inn.

    Public Transportation (Minibus)

    To reach Chintheche INN via public transport, find a minibus heading south from Mzuzu. You can catch these minibuses from the main bus station in Mzuzu. The fare will typically range from 1,500 to 2,500 MWK (Malawi Kwacha). Inform the driver that you're going to Chintheche. The journey takes about 1.5 to 2 hours. Once you arrive at the Chintheche bus stop, the inn is a short walk away from the main road; just follow the signs or ask locals for directions.

    Taxi

    For a more comfortable option, you can hire a taxi from Mzuzu to Chintheche INN. This is particularly convenient if you're traveling with a group or have a lot of luggage. The taxi fare may vary, but expect to pay between 30,000 to 50,000 MWK. The journey will take approximately 1 to 1.5 hours, depending on traffic. Make sure to negotiate the fare before starting your journey.

    Bicycle

    For the adventurous, cycling to Chintheche INN can be a rewarding experience. Rent a bicycle in Mzuzu and take the M5 road towards Chintheche. The distance is about 70 km, and it may take around 4 to 5 hours depending on your pace. Ensure to carry enough water and snacks for the journey, and be cautious of traffic along the road.

    Discover more about Chintheche INN

    Chintheche Inn is a picturesque hotel located along the mesmerizing shores of Lake Malawi,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its stunning biodiversity and crystal-clear waters. The Inn provides an ideal getaway for tourists looking to immerse themselves in the tranquil atmosphere of this beautiful region. With comfortable accommodations that offer magnificent views of the lake, guests can enjoy the serene backdrop of swaying palm trees and vibrant sunsets. The Inn's location makes it an excellent base for exploring the surrounding areas, including local markets and cultural experiences that showcase the rich heritage of Malawi.Visitors to Chintheche Inn can engage in a variety of activities that highlight the natural beauty of Lake Malawi. Swimming, snorkeling, and kayaking are just a few popular water sports that allow guests to discover the vibrant underwater life. For those inclined towards land-based adventures, hiking trails nearby offer stunning vistas and opportunities to connect with the diverse flora and fauna of the region. Additionally, the Inn's warm and welcoming staff are always ready to assist with recommendations and local insights, ensuring that every guest's stay is memorable.The nearby local village provides an excellent opportunity for tourists to experience Malawian culture firsthand. Engaging with the friendly locals and purchasing handmade crafts can enrich your travel experience and provide a deeper understanding of the community. Whether you are seeking relaxation by the lake or adventure in nature, Chintheche Inn promises an unforgettable stay in one of Africa's most beautiful destinations.
